"espiguilla" meaning in Spanish

See espiguilla in All languages combined, or Wiktionary

Noun

IPA: /espiˈɡiʝa/, [es.piˈɣ̞i.ʝa], /espiˈɡiʝa/ (note: most of Spain and Latin America), [es.piˈɣ̞i.ʝa] (note: most of Spain and Latin America), /espiˈɡiʎa/ (note: rural northern Spain, Andes Mountains), [es.piˈɣ̞i.ʎa] (note: rural northern Spain, Andes Mountains), /espiˈɡiʃa/ (note: Buenos Aires and environs), [es.piˈɣ̞i.ʃa] (note: Buenos Aires and environs), /espiˈɡiʒa/ (note: elsewhere in Argentina and Uruguay), [es.piˈɣ̞i.ʒa] (note: elsewhere in Argentina and Uruguay) Forms: espiguillas [plural]
Rhymes: -iʝa, -iʝa, -iʎa, -iʃa, -iʒa Etymology: From espiga + -illa. Etymology templates: {{af|es|espiga|-illa}} espiga + -illa Head templates: {{es-noun|f}} espiguilla f (plural espiguillas)
  1. diminutive of espiga Tags: diminutive, feminine, form-of Form of: espiga
    Sense id: en-espiguilla-es-noun-7zM2BqcO
  2. herringbone pattern Tags: feminine
    Sense id: en-espiguilla-es-noun-uklg5aSI
  3. annual meadow grass (Poa annua) Tags: feminine
